Beethoven's Fifth Symphony: Body percussion or body tap
In this video clip we see Choeur des Colibris at work. The youngsters bring a very beautiful graphic version interspersed with body percussion of Beethoven's fifth symphony.
This body tap version was arranged and conducted by Nelly Guilhemsans.

Winter Spirits: Song around sound with chords and lesson ideas
Winter Spirits is about the terrifying sounds you sometimes hear in the dark.
It is ideal for lessons on sound. In the appendix you will find the text with chords as well as a number of lesson ideas.
